Hyundai Elantra: Blind-Spot Collision Warning (BCW) / System disabled
.png)
When the rear bumper around the rear
corner radar or sensor is covered with
foreign material, such as snow or rain,
or installing a trailer or carrier, it can
reduce the detecting performance and
temporarily limit or disable Blind-Spot
Safety system.
If this occurs, the ‘Blind-Spot Safety
system(s) disabled. Radar blocked’
warning message will appear on the
cluster.
The system will operate normally when
such foreign material or trailer, etc.
is removed, and then the engine is
restarted.
If the system does not operate normally
after it is removed, we recommend
that the system be inspected by an
authorized HYUNDAI dealer.
WARNING
- Even though the warning message
does not appear on the cluster, Blind-
Spot Safety system may not properly
operate.
- Blind-Spot Safety system may not
properly operate in an area (e.g. open
terrain), where any substance are
not detected right after the engine
is turned on, or when the detecting
sensor is blocked with foreign
material right after the engine is
turned on.
CAUTION
Turn off Blind-Spot Safety system to
install a trailer, carrier, etc., or remove
the trailer, carrier, etc. to use Blind-Spot
Safety system.
